Abstract

The right coronary artery arising from the left anterior descending artery is a rare coronary artery anomaly. In a 56-year-old female, an anomaly with the right coronary artery, originating from the left anterior descending artery, coursing anteriorly to the pulmonary artery was detected by cardiac CT. Therefore, we hereby report a case of the single left coronary artery diagnosed by a 64-slice multidetector cardiac CT.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
